One activist group is hoping to turn moviegoers into voters with a new campaign aimed at fans of Black Panther.
The EJP’s efforts were recently profiled in The Wrap. The group’s founders stated that they believe Wakanda – the fictional nation depicted in Black Panther – to be symbolic of the sort of society the EJP hopes to begin building in The United States.
Given that Black Panther could make more money in its opening weekend than the original The Avengers movie, this seems a wise move.
